Unsteady effects of vortex interaction on tip leakage vortex breakdown and its loss mechanism

Aerospace Science and Technology, 2018
Abstract In an unshrouded high-pressure turbine, tip leakage flow causes a loss of efficiency. The loss mechanisms of tip leakage flow were investigated mostly with steady uniform incoming conditions in previous studies. This paper investigated the unsteady aerodynamic performance of the tip leakage flow in a turbine stage by solving Unsteady ...

Development of a tip leakage loss model for high-pressure turbines with squealer tips based on physics-driven and data-driven methods

Physics of Fluids
Tip leakage loss significantly influences aerodynamic performance of high-pressure turbines, with squealer tips serving as an effective control strategy. The development of a tip leakage loss model is crucial for evaluating and predicting turbine aerodynamic performance and guiding blade tip design.
